Transaction 16deadf7958aeb05809445e2af19f5f9dabbf885e7b4e1e68d64530ed6703eca

1 Input
2 Outputs
  • 16deadf7958aeb05809445e2af19f5f9dabbf885e7b4e1e68d64530ed6703eca:0
  • value  40000000
    address  3AJERZr9vUvJFxgcPwFZh1CHxwpZwcYQu1
  • 16deadf7958aeb05809445e2af19f5f9dabbf885e7b4e1e68d64530ed6703eca:1
  • value  2858264426
    address  1J37CY8hcdUXQ1KfBhMCsUVafa8XjDsdCn